Originally Posted by feline fanatic
Mariner's Compass is one of my favorite blocks, combine that block with batiks as you have and I am just drooling. Yours is just breathtaking! I love the color scheme you chose for it and the sawtooth sashing really sets them off beautifully. Did you use Judy Matheison's technique for making them?

Also wishing you a successful surgery and speedy recovery.
I had to look up Judy Mathieson on line to see what her technique was but it appears I would have to purchase one of her books or patterns in order to answer your question. I just used the paper piecing patterns from the 2007 Fons & Porter magazine. (I think it was March-April). Thanks for the compliments & the good wishes!!
